Increase the RP for particular automated tours


Imperial

Question

The number of tours on MMO are great (1-2 per day at different timezones), and that is something I would personally like to keep happening. However what I've noticed is that the quality of these tournaments regarding prizes have decreased and I believe needs some kind of change.

 

Suggestion:

As I accept that the developers are sensitive about including too many shiny prizes, I would like to propose increasing the RP prizes in non-shiny tours to the following:

  • 1st place - 1,500 RP (currently 1,000 RP)
  • 2nd place - 750 RP (currently 500 RP)
  • 3rd place - 500 RP (currently 250 RP)

 

Justification:

There has been a significant decrease in the number of tournaments with shiny prizes, especially in tiers such as UU. Below are the difference in tournaments which have non-shiny prizes compared to shiny prizes (excluding Community Combats).

 

All of the tournaments are from the beginning of August until the end of this week (as who has time to go further):

From the tournaments I've listed, UU is the tier which is lacking in the most shiny prizes. With these type of tournaments, people would rather enjoy the aesthetics of a shiny than a 'perfect non-shiny' prize, and this shows based on the brackets.

 

I believe the increase in RP prize should also happen for the following reasons:

 

  • Bearminator has confirmed that discussions will occur to increase the Team Tournament prizes from 1,000 RP in 2022
  • Players can grind an average of 300-500k a day or more depending on their time and methods (e.g. Gym runs, farming berries, etc) so this increase shouldn't affect the economy is a negative way
  • It will increase the hype for some of these tournaments, in particular ones which start really late for European players or those who aren't motivated by non-shiny prizes

 

I was recommended by a staff member to suggest it here - I know there's been many great suggestions which have been ignored, but I hope this can be remotely considered.

 

Please feel free to discuss.
